Verification – Why KYC Matters and How to Speed It Up

KYC (Know Your Customer) is a legal requirement for all licensed Australian betting sites, Pointsbet included. After you’ve signed up, you’ll be prompted to upload a scanned copy of your driver’s licence or passport, plus a recent utility bill to prove address. The upload portal accepts JPG, PNG or PDF, and most users see their documents approved within an hour.

If you want faster verification, make sure the images are clear, the file size under 5 MB, and the details match exactly what you entered during registration. In rare cases, the compliance team may request a selfie holding the ID – this extra step is just to keep your account safe from fraud.

Security, Licensing and Responsible Gambling

Pointsbet operates under a licence from the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A) and complies with the Interactive Gambling Act. All data is encrypted with 128‑bit SSL, and the platform undergoes regular third‑party audits to ensure fair play. Your personal and financial information is stored in secure, ISO‑27001‑certified data centres.

For responsible gambling, Pointsbet provides self‑exclusion tools, deposit limits and a “Reality Check” pop‑up that reminds you of session length. If you ever feel you need help, the “Responsible Gaming” section links directly to Lifeline and Gambling Help Online, two trusted Australian charities.
